Pure Soybean Oil
Soybean oil has emerged a favorite choice for both cooking and baking. Famous for its gentle texture, soybean oil easily blends into numerous meals. Its high smoke point makes it perfect for high-heat cooking methods like frying and sauteing.
Moreover, soybean oil is a good source of essential fatty acids. Its versatility allows it to be used in diverse selection of culinary applications, from basic dishes to elaborate food preparations.

Mastering of Cooking Spaghetti
Achieving that spot-on al dente texture in spaghetti is a culinary skill. It's not simply about cooking the noodles for a certain length of time; it's about understanding their journey as they immerse in boiling water.
- Initiate by choosing high-quality spaghetti made from wheat flour, which retains its shape beautifully.
- Simmer a large pot of flavored water to a rolling boil.
- Add the spaghetti and agitate gently to stop it from sticking together.
- Simmer for 8-10 minutes, tasting occasionally until the pasta is firm to the bite but tender.
Once cooked, remove the spaghetti in a colander and gently rinse it with lukewarm water to stop the cooking process.
